VILLAGE OF AGENCY v. CITY OF ST. JOSEPH

WD 79220.

502 S.W.3d 726 (2016)

VILLAGE OF AGENCY, Missouri, Appellant, v. CITY OF ST. JOSEPH, Missouri, et al., Respondents.

Missouri Court of Appeals, Western District.

Opinion Filed: October 25, 2016.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Ronald R. Holliday , St. Joseph, MO, for appellant.

Paul A. Campo , Bryan E. Carter , Lee's Summit, MO, for respondents.

Before Division One: Thomas H. Newton, Presiding Judge, Cynthia L. Martin, Judge and Edward R. Ardini, Jr., Judge.


Village of Agency, Missouri ("Village") appeals the trial court's denial of a petition which sought a declaration authorizing an involuntary annexation.
